The Mechanics of a Rising Multiplier

The fundamental operation of this virtual flight system relies on a random number generator that determines the crash point of the aircraft. Every time the plane takes off, a new sequence is initiated, and the multiplier begins to climb from one point zero zero up to potentially massive numbers. The user does not have any control over the flight path or the duration of the ascent, but they do have full control over when they decide to exit the round. This creates a unique environment where the player is the primary driver of their own success or failure through their timing.

This process is governed by a set of rules that ensure fairness and transparency. Most modern versions utilize a provably fair system, which means the results are not manipulated by a house edge in a way that is invisible to the user. Instead, the outcome is generated via a cryptographic hash, allowing the player to verify that the the flight ended at a specific multiplier regardless of any external influence. This level of transparency builds trust and encourages players to experiment with different betting patterns and timing strategies.

Common Betting Patterns

Many experienced participants use a combination of two different bets on the same flight to hedge their risks. This technique involves placing a larger bet with a low target multiplier to cover the costs of both bets, and a smaller bet with a higher target to seek a larger profit. This way, the larger bet is cashed out early, ensuring a baseline of safety, while the smaller bet is left to climb, providing the possibility of a significant win without risking the entire stake for that round.

This dual-betting approach is a powerful tool for reducing volatility. It allows the player to maintain a psychological sense of security, knowing that they have already secured a portion of their funds. It also removes the pressure of having to make a split-second decision for a single large bet, as the player can focus their attention on the ascending multiplier. This method is widely regarded as one of the most effective ways to maintain a stable bankroll while still enjoying the thrill of the high-altitude flights.

Technological Foundations of Predictable Fairness

The underlying technology that powers the modern aviator game is designed to ensure that neither the operator nor the player can manipulate the outcome of the flight. This is achieved through the use of a Provably Fair algorithm, which is a standard in the modern, transparent digital gaming industry. The server seed, combined with client seeds provided by the player or other players in the round, creates a unique hash that is generated before the round begins. This hash contains the result of the flight in a way that is encrypted and unchangeable.

This system ensures that the result is determined by mathematical certainty rather than by a change in the software's logic during the flight. When the plane flies away, the player can take the result hash and enter it into a third-party verifier to confirm that the plane would have crashed at that specific multiplier. This level of transparency is designed to prevent any accusations of fraud and provides a player with a psychological sense of security, knowing that the game is fair and fair for everyone involved regardless of their stake.

Integrating the Auto-Cashout Feature

The auto-cashout feature is a powerful tool for those who want to eliminate the human element of hesitation. By setting a specific multiplier, the system will automatically exit the round for the player as soon as that number is reached. This removes the a psychological struggle between greed and fear, as the decision has already been made before the flight begins. It is an excellent way to implement a rigid strategy, such as the low-target strategy, where the user can be certain that they will secure their winnings at 1.20x or 1.50x without any delay.

The use of auto-cashout also reduces the stress associated with the time-critical nature of the movement. Because the system handles the exit, the player can relax and watch the plane climb, knowing that their strategy is implemented with mathematical precision. However, the danger of this feature is that it can lead to a player to become too passive, ignoring the dynamic nature of the a flight. The best approach is to combine the auto-cashout for a base bet and a manual cash-out for a high-risk bet to maintain a balance of strategic rigidity and intuitive timing.
